Intersect ENT Reports Second Quarter 2014 Results
September 3, 2014 4:01 PM EDTMENLO PARK, Calif., Sept. 3, 2014 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Intersect ENT, Inc. (Nasdaq: XENT), a company dedicated to improving the quality of life for patients with ear, nose and throat conditions, today reported financial results for the second quarter of 2014.
Recent Accomplishments
Achieved Q2 revenue of $8.6 million, an increase of 118% over the second quarter of 2013  Realized gross margin of 73%, an increase of 66% from 44% in the second quarter of the prior year  Completed an initial public offering, raising $63.3M in gross proceeds  Completed the RESOLVE clinical study...
